Celine Dion is a singer from Canada. The most popular recording artist in the French-speaking world and Canada, Celine Dion is mostly recognized for her strong and technically flawless voice. She has blended pop, rock, R&B, gospel, classical music, and other genres into her songs. Since then, she has primarily recorded in English and French, but she has also sang in Latin, Chinese, Japanese, Chinese, Spanish, Italian, and German. Born into a large family in Charlemagne, Quebec, Dion rose to fame as a teenager in her own country during the 1980s, largely due to a series of French-language records. She rose to international fame in 1988 after winning the Eurovision Song Contest with the song “Ne partez pas sans moi.” Her first, Unison (1990).

Raised in a small hamlet close to Montreal as the youngest of 14 children, Dion started performing with her musically minded family at the age of five. René Angélil, the impresario, saw her when she was 12 years old. She finally married him in 1994, and he launched her career with the album La Voix du beau Dieu (1981; “The Voice of God”). Later, in 1982, Dion took home a prize from the World Popular Song Festival in Tokyo. The following year, she was honored with the first of many Félix awards, which are given to Quebec performers. She was also the first Canadian to receive a gold record in France in 1983. When Dion was asked to compete in the 1988 Eurovision Song Contest on behalf of Switzerland, she won with her rendition of “Ne partez.”
Celine Dion Net Worth
Forbes projects Céline Dion’s net worth to reach an incredible $550 million by 2025. Her enormous pop career is undoubtedly to blame for this, but she’s also a cunning businesswoman. She owns a golf course, invested in Las Vegas’ Pure nightclub, has a popular accessory line, co-founded the Canadian chain restaurant Nickels, co-owns the Schwartz’s deli, has a fragrance line, and is an ambassador for Air Canada, the airline that she recorded her song “You And I” for.
